This article is not about caves. It is about the TN Metro Solid Waste Advisory Board who approved a new dump site - a quarry - but it does mention the Rumbling Falls Cave system. Gold Mine on the Harpeth by Martin Holsinger <snip> " Neither State Senator Douglas Henry nor State Representative Gary Moore, in whose districts the quarry lies, seem inclined to amend the State Scenic Rivers Act, which they helped write. Sen. Henry did qualify this, saying “I'm one of the authors of the State Scenic Rivers Act and unless the Department of Conservation recommends a change I'm not going to change it.” My friends in the conservation struggle are concerned about a certain pliability they perceive in the Tennessee Department of Environment and Conservation. After all, the Department of Water Quality approved the discharge of sewage into the Rumbling Falls Cave system, and it took a lawsuit to stop them. This may take another lawsuit before it's over.
